Moving from Austin to Dayton

Moving from Austin, Texas to Dayton, Ohio covers approximately 1,007 miles, classifying this as an interstate move. Pricing depends on factors like the size of your household goods and the level of service required. Delivery typically takes around 2 days, with options for standard or expedited service. Understanding these elements helps you plan your move efficiently.

How much does it cost to move from Austin to Dayton?

Expect moving costs from Austin to Dayton to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,306 to $1,356, medium moves from $1,502 to $1,559, and large moves from $1,698 to $1,763.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es from professional movers can help you find the best fit for your budget.

Answers to popular questions about moving from Austin to Dayton

Here are answers to common questions about moving from Austin, Texas to Dayton, Ohio to help you plan your relocation.

How much does it typically cost to move from Austin to Dayton?

Moving costs from Austin to Dayton vary by the size of your move. Small moves generally cost between $1,306 and $1,356, medium moves range from $1,502 to $1,559, and large moves fall between $1,698 and $1,763. Additional services and timing can affect these estimates.

What is the usual delivery timeline for this interstate move?

Delivery from Austin to Dayton typically takes about 2 days, whether you choose standard or expedited service. This timeline accounts for the 1,007-mile distance and standard transit schedules used by professional movers.

What is the cheapest moving option for this route?

The most affordable option is usually a small move with basic services. Opting for self-packing and flexible delivery dates can also reduce costs. Comparing quotes from multiple long distance movers helps identify the best price.

When should I book my move to get the best rates?

Booking your move several weeks in advance often secures better rates and availability. Avoiding peak moving seasons and weekends can also help lower costs and ensure smoother scheduling.

Are movers from Austin to Dayton required to have interstate licenses?

Yes, movers operating between Texas and Ohio must be licensed interstate movers. This ensures compliance with federal regulations and protects your shipment during the long distance move.

What logistics should I consider for this interstate move?

Key logistics include coordinating pickup and delivery dates, understanding the distance and transit time, and deciding on additional services like packing or storage. Working with experienced interstate moving companies can simplify these details.
